Jean Appolon’s ANGAJE

Boston Center for the Arts - The Plaza Theatre
The dates for this event have passed

With the electric choreography of Jean Appolon, and set to the music of Haitian legend Toto Bissainthe, ANGAJE is a full-length production inspired by the struggle against homophobia and the power of Haitian folkloric culture in the fight for justice.   In Haitian Creole, “Angaje” means “committed” or “engaged.” A talk back with Appolon and … Continued

Subject:Matter presents Some Pulp

The Center for Arts at the Armory
The dates for this event have passed

Subject:Matter presents Some Pulp, a collaboration between big band composer Steve Bass and Subject:Matter director/choreographer Ian Berg. Some Pulp is an evening of new and exciting tap dance and superb swing music for a Boston audience.
